Chris_H_2 wrote:The problem is that the band is trying to accommodate Nels Cline's "sound," which often makes the songs languish.

Bottom line: this band misses Jim O'Rourke and/or Jay Bennet.
I actually disagree with that. I think the main reason Sky Blue Sky was so surprising to people was that everyone thought when Nels came on board they were going to go even further down the AGIB-guitar skronk rabbit hole. They've kept that live, but I think there's only been a few examples of things on their last records (Bull Black Nova, Art of Almost) where they've done what I think people were expecting more of when Nels came on.
Fuck I wish they would have gotten weirder and continued to grow in the direction of AGIB, but oh well.

Yeah, his son is drumming. I actually saw the band they've put together to tour the record last night. They played about a dozen of the new tracks. Diamond Light was the only skronky guitar song; most of the rest were more languid folk tunes. But they sounded beautiful, and the lyrics I was able to catch sounded fantastic.
